Just as an FYI, Cali $10s are often red... and occasionally share the spot pattern of the $5s (iirc). I've also seen red Cali quarters (El Dorado is a solid red Paulson HS; Hollywood Park is sort of an Adobe red BJ HS).
Fairly standard Cali progression (including lots of "in-between" chips) is:
{Orange, Red, Pink, or Brown} fractional, Blue $1, Green $2, Pink $3, Yellow $5, Red (or Plum/Brown) $10, Black $20, Purple $25, White $100.
